Employment Statistics
8,091 residents are over the age of 16 and 5,631 people are in labor force. Among them, 5,631 people are in civilian labor force and 0 are in armed labor force. 5,377 people are employed and the unemployment rate is 4.50%.

Average Income and Health Insurance
The average household income is $149,990 for the 3,657 households in Littleton School District area, Massachusetts. The average income of a single worker is $63,431. 9,879 people have a health insurance and the health insurance coverage rate is 99.34%.
Housing
There are 3,836 housing units in Littleton School District area, Massachusetts with 3,657 units (95.33%) occupied. 3,230 houses (88.32%) are occupied by owner and 427 houses (11.68%) are rented. The average housing value is $459,000 and the average rental cost is $1,292. 196 houses (5.11%) were newly built in 2014 or later and 864 houses (22.52%) were built in 1949 or earlier.
Demographic
A total of 10,071 people lives in Littleton School District area, Massachusetts with 4,952 male and 5,119 female. The males to female ratio is 49.17 to 50.83. The tables below describes the population by gender, age, and race.
